New thread for the actual tank I'm setting up -- here's my current status:
~ Tank ~
40g regular non-drilled glass tank (36"x14.5"x16.5" -- so more like 37g actually)
~ Plan ~
FOWLR initially, probably will upgrade to reef eventually
Stocking entirely TBD -- maybe clowns, cardinals, chromis, gobies, hawks...who knows!
Will start with K.I.S.S. approach and buy additional equipment as needed
~ Assets ~
20W 50/50 bulb --> Will upgrade for corals
API Saltwater Master Test Kit
Hydrometer --> Will upgrade to refractometer if needed
AC 50 Powerhead (270 gph) --> Will upgrade / add if more flow needed
50 lbs Caribsea Aragonite sand
25 lb black lace base rock
Oceanic salt mix
~ Next Steps ~
Get a heater (I think I got one and lost it somewhere ... doh.)
Assemble components
Get pure water --> plan to start out with RO grocery store water (not sure if I can find RO/DI) and get a RO/DI unit if that makes sense
Start up tank and add live rock
